Contents:
Roles and anchors of semantic situations / André Wlodarczyk -- Frames of semantic situations / André Wlodarczyk -- Grounding of the meta-informative status of utterances / André Wlodarczyk -- Attention-centered information in language / Hélène Wlodarczyk -- Semantic and episodic memory with respect to the ontological grounding of the old and new meta-informative status / Franz J. Stachowiak -- Tracing the role of memory and attention for the meta-informative validation of utterances / Franz J. Stachowiak -- It-clefts in the meta-informative structure of the utterance in modern and present-day English / Ana E. Martínez-Insua & Javier Pérez Guerra -- Discourse coherence and referent identification of subject ellipsis in Japanese / Shigeko Nariyama -- Structure of centre of attention in a multi-party conversation in Japanese: Based on the data of a review meeting concerning a Science Café held in Hiroshima / Miki Saijo -- Verbal aspect in Slavic languages between semantics and pragmatics / Hélène Wlodarczyk -- Object personal and reflexive pronouns as centres of attention of base and extended utterances in classical modern literary Russian / Olivier Azam -- Tonic and atonic pronouns in classical Greek: A pragmatic choice by the speaker / Jean-Christophe Pitavy -- Personal subject pronouns and the meta-informative centering of utterances in classical Latin / Perrine Vedrenne-Cloquet.
